Koraji - Sangrampur, Munger

Koraji is a village situated in the Sangrampur subdivision of Munger district, Bihar. It is located approximately 7 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sangrampur and around 50 km from the district headquarters in Munger. Rampur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Koraji village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Koraji is 243328. The village covers a total geographical area of 128 hectares and falls under the 813212 pincode. Kharagpur is the nearest town, located about 19 km away.

Koraji village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Koraji

As per Census 2011, Koraji village has a total population of 1,304 people, consisting of 674 males and 630 females. The village has 218 households and a sex ratio of 934 females per 1,000 males. There are 285 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 496 literate and 808 illiterate residents. Additionally, 769 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Koraji

Koraji is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Kharagpur to Koraji is about 19 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Munger to Koraji is about 50 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
